Distance from Huatusco to Shanghai

The distance between Huatusco, Mexico and Shanghai, China is 13,092 kilometers (8,135 miles).

Huatusco, Veracruz, Mexico

Shanghai, China

From Huatusco to Shanghai, the straight-line distance is 13,092 kilometers, heading northwest. Huatusco is situated at an altitude of 1,290 meters above sea level, while Shanghai is at only 12 meters.

Travel time

Mode Estimated time
Airplane 1 day
Jet fighter 14-16 hours
Speed Time
300 km/h
Huatusco, Mexico

Local time:

Time Zone: America/Mexico_City

Coordinates: 19.1488° N 96.9676° W

Elevation: 1,290 m (4,232 ft)


Nearby airports:
  • El Lencero Airport (JAL)
  • General Heriberto Jara International Airport (VER)
  • Tehuacán Airport (TCN)
  • Hermanos Serdán International Airport (PBC)
  • El Tajín National Airport (PAZ)
Shanghai, China

Local time:

Time Zone: Asia/Shanghai

Coordinates: 31.2222° N 121.4581° E

Elevation: 12 m (39 ft)


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Huatusco

Distance between cities Kilometers
From Huatusco to Mexico City 229 km
From Huatusco to Tijuana 2,487 km
From Huatusco to Iztapalapa 221 km
From Huatusco to Puebla 131 km
From Huatusco to Ciudad Juárez 1,687 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Chengdu 1,661 km
From Shanghai to Tianjin 961 km
From Shanghai to Wuhan 691 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Huatusco and Shanghai.

From To Distance (kilometers)
Ottawa, Canada Chennai, India 13,092 km
Delhi, India Mexicali, Mexico 13,092 km
Memphis, United States Kakamega, Kenya 13,091 km
Santiago, Chile Istanbul, Turkey 13,091 km
Nairobi, Kenya Winnipeg, Canada 13,091 km
Cali, Colombia Tehran, Iran 13,090 km
Cochabamba, Bolivia Sydney, Australia 13,094 km
La Paz, Bolivia Newcastle, Australia 13,090 km
Indianapolis, United States Nagpur, India 13,090 km
Canberra, Australia Cochabamba, Bolivia 13,094 km
Denver, United States Indore, India 13,090 km
New South Memphis, United States Kakamega, Kenya 13,095 km
San Francisco, United States Ahmedabad, India 13,095 km
San Pedro Sula, Honduras Seoul, South Korea 13,089 km
Istanbul, Turkey Puente Alto, Chile 13,095 km
Hermosillo, Mexico Melbourne, Australia 13,089 km
Ahmedabad, India Oakland, United States 13,095 km
Taipei, Taiwan León de los Aldama, Mexico 13,095 km
Mexicali, Mexico New Delhi, India 13,095 km

Measure more distances between cities